Actions to Refurbish French Doors

Refurbishing your French doors can be a gratifying DIY project, or, if preferred, a professional can carry out the work. Below are in-depth steps to effectively refurbish your doors.

1. Assess the Condition

Action: Examine the doors carefully. Try to find signs of damage, such as rot, warping, or cracks.

ConditionService
Minor ScratchesSand down and repaint or stain.
Moderate DamageUsage wood filler to repair and after that sand down.
Extreme RotReplace affected panels or consult a professional.

2. Eliminate Hardware

Action: Remove any handles, locks, or hinges.

3. Clean the Doors

Action: Use a moderate cleaning agent and water option to clean up the doors.

4. Sand the Surface

Action: Sand the doors to remove old paint, stain, or varnish. Start with coarse grit and shift to great grit.

5. Repair Damages

  • Fill: Use wood filler for fractures and holes.
  • Change: If there's serious rot, replace the damaged parts.

6. Refinish the Doors

Choose either to paint or stain. Follow these actions:

  1. Primer: Apply an ideal primer if painting.
  2. Paint/Stain: Apply a very first coat and permit to dry. Sand gently and apply a second coat.

7. Reinstall Hardware

When the paint or stain has actually treated, reinstall all hardware, ensuring whatever functions properly.

8. Set Up Weather Stripping

For included energy performance, set up new weather condition removing along the edges of the doors.

9. Final Inspection

Do a last check to ensure all elements are running smoothly and look visually enticing.

Common Issues to Address During Refurbishment

Throughout the refurbishment procedure, a number of common issues might occur that need dealing with.

  • Drafts: Replace seals and weather stripping to remove air leakages.
  • Sticking: Sand down locations where doors stick; this could indicate misalignment.
  • Locks: Ensure all locks are working and consider changing any malfunctioning locks.

1. How frequently should French doors be reconditioned?

French doors need to be checked every couple of years for indications of wear. Regular maintenance can extend the time in between refurbishments.

2. Can I refurbish my French doors if they are made of fiberglass?

Yes, fiberglass doors can be refurbished. Take notice of the specific care guidelines for fiberglass products.

3. What tools will I need for refurbishment?

Standard tools include:

  • Screwdrivers
  • Sandpaper or a power sander
  • Wood filler
  • Paintbrushes or rollers
  • Guide and paint or wood stain
  • Weather condition removing

4. Is it much better to repaint or stain my French doors?

This typically depends on individual preference. Staining reveals the wood grain but needs more maintenance. Painting uses a more comprehensive color choice however may conceal the wood's natural beauty.

5. Should I hire a professional or do it myself?

This depends on your confidence and skill level. DIY can be rewarding and cost-efficient, but hiring a professional ensures a high standard of workmanship.
